# Settings for the Bramblewood hermetic build migration.
# Heads up for the sync: we're pinning toolchains now, so no more
# "works on my machine" fun. Network access is sandboxed except the
# artifact cache. Build metadata still lands in the shared metrics DB,
# which you can reach with the connection string below.

replica DSN, kajep-yahag: mssql://praok_svc:iF@db-8d68.plorvaio.local:5432/eliion

Handover for the Pairline matching service, from Edda to Soren. The GC pauses we've been chasing spike during the evening reshuffle window, when the candidate cache balloons past 6 GB and the old-gen collector stalls for 400–700 ms. I've landed a partial fix that shards the cache per region; the remaining PRs tune heap ratios and need careful review of the eviction logic. Full pause histograms, tuning experiments, and the rejected alternatives are documented on the page below.

wiki page, tahaf-tajog: https://jira.ordindyn.corp/pipeline

## Handling rounding drift in FexoRate conversions

Plugin authors: FexoRate returns amounts in minor units, but conversions between currencies with differing exponents can accumulate sub-cent residue. Always round half-even after the final conversion step, never per line item, or reconciliation against the Ledgerette service will flag your plugin. To verify your rounding behavior, call the internal reconciliation endpoint with the sandbox credential below.

service key, fawip-bajef: kto11_Qt5wZK9vdNC

**CI note: rate-parity checker flakes**

The Tollgate rate-parity checker for the Silvermere hotel feeds sometimes fails in CI because the fixture snapshots drift from the mock supplier responses. If you see a parity mismatch on an untouched branch, regenerate the fixtures with the refresh script in the tools directory and re-run — don't hand-edit the snapshots. Real parity bugs show up as per-property diffs, not whole-file churn. If the failure persists after a fixture refresh, compare your run against the build below.

pipeline stamp: htk9_ce63042d9